Introduction

Kunio Kobayashi is a prominent inventor based in Saitama, Japan, renowned for his contributions to pharmaceutical research and development. With a total of 14 patents to his name, he has significantly impacted the fields of medicinal chemistry and therapeutic innovations.

Latest Patents

Among his latest inventions is the P2X4 receptor antagonist, a complex diazepine derivative designed to provide therapeutic benefits. Career Highlights

Kobayashi has worked with notable organizations including Nippon Chemiphar Co., Ltd. and Kyushu University. His roles at these institutions have allowed him to leverage his expertise in drug development and contribute to groundbreaking discoveries in the pharmaceutical sector.

Collaborations

Throughout his career, Kunio Kobayashi has collaborated with esteemed colleagues such as Shogo Sakuma and Toshiyasu Imai. These partnerships have fostered a collaborative environment that stimulates innovation and problem-solving in the challenges faced by the pharmaceutical industry.
